MARCONI v. CHICAGO HEIGHTS POLICE PENSION

No. 101418.

870 N.E.2d 273 (2006)

225 Ill.2d 497

Anthony MARCONI, Appellee, v. The CHICAGO HEIGHTS POLICE PENSION BOARD et al., Appellants.

Supreme Court of Illinois.

As Modified Upon Denial of Rehearing May 29, 2007.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mathias W. Delort and Aaron G. Allen, of Robbins, Schwartz, Nicholas, Lifton & Taylor, Ltd., Chicago, for appellants.

Jerome F. Marconi, Chicago, for appellee.

Roger Huebner, Springfield, for amicus curiae Illinois Municipal League.

Cary J. Collins and Joseph Crimmins, Hoffman Estates, for amicus curiae Illinois Public Pension Advisory Committee.


OPINION

PER CURIAM:

Plaintiff, Anthony Marconi, filed an application for a disability pension with defendant Chicago Heights Police Pension Board (Board). During the pendency of the Board's review of plaintiff's application for a disability pension, plaintiff filed suit in the circuit court of Cook County, requesting, inter alia, a declaratory judgment that the Board did not timely complete review of his application.
